Flow Form Heat Shrink Tubing 20 to 18 AWG Gray
(Pack of
5.0)
3:1 shrink ratio
Prevents failure due to corrosion, vibration, abrasion and strain
Sturdy dual wall construction the outer wall shrinks, providing strength, rigidity and abrasion resistance, while the inner wall provides a water-resistant seal to keep out contaminants and water
Chemical-resistant not affected by road salt, oil, diesel fuel, gasoline, dust, moisture and battery acid
Easy to install shrinks with a heat gun, torch or other heat source
Color-coded for easy size identification
Easily cuts to size
High dielectric strength: 500V/mil; up to 16,000V per application
Temperature range: 67°F to +230°F (55°C to +110°C)
Voltage rating in USA 600V; in Canada 32V
Applications
Electrical terminals and connectors exposed to corrosion, pull-out or vibration
Repair welding cables and insulate stingers and lugs
Installation and repair of vehicular equipment wiring and lights
Strain relief for robotic applications
Insulate tool handles to reduce electric shock
Seal butt connectors for in-line splices
Wire gauge coverage is approximate due to the wide variance of wire thicknesses.
